High refractive index ensuring superior opacity and hiding power in final formulations.
Optimized particle size distribution for excellent dispersion stability in aqueous and solvent-based systems.
Surface-treated with silica and alumina to enhance weather resistance and reduce photocatalytic activity.
Consistent batch-to-batch quality meeting ISO 591-1:2020 standards for pigmentary titanium dioxide.
Low volatile organic compound (VOC) content, supporting compliance with stringent environmental regulations.
Architectural and industrial coatings requiring high whiteness and durability.
Plastic masterbatches for polyolefins, PVC, and engineering resins.
Printing inks—especially offset, flexographic, and gravure formulations.
Automotive OEM and refinish coatings demanding gloss retention and UV stability.
High-performance powder coatings for outdoor applications.
